There are only 4 "outer planets". They are Jupiter Saturn Uranus and Neptune. There are 5 planets outside the Earth's orbit. They are the above 4 plus Mars. These 5 are called the "superior planets".

The outer Solar System is the part outside the orbit of Mars. This region of the Solar System is home to four planets and numerous dwarf planets. The planets are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us and Neptune.
